As Australias largest automotive OEM employer we proudly have around 1500 talented engineers designers and specialists working across five Victorian sites. Crucially Australia is a key global development hub for Ford and our local design and engineering team lead the creation of vehicles including the Ranger Ranger Raptor and Everest models sold in around 180 markets worldwide.

About the Role

As a Body / Chassis & Crash Test Supervisor you will be responsible for managing and coordinating all Body and Chassis Laboratory testing and Full Vehicle Crash testing for all IMG vehicle development programs and running change activities. This will involve working cross functionally with multiple customers to LEAN test plans whilst maximising the output of the labs testing this role you will also have the lead in driving the labs proactive Quality initiatives. This position reports directly to the Facilities and Test Operations Manager and is based our Geelong research and development centre and our proving ground in Lara. It is predominantly an onsite role with a minimum of four to five days in the office.



Responsibilities
  • Lead a team of experienced test engineers across the Body/Chassis Test Lab and the You Yangs Crash Barrier.

  • Manage and coordinate all Body Chassis and Vehicle Crash DV testing for all IMG vehicle programs and cost reduction activities.

  • Coordinate with all stakeholders to deliver efficient DV plans to minimize prototype bucks and crash vehicle counts

  • Benchmark new testing technologies globally and plan the most efficient facility and Capital Investment spend to maintain global testing capability

  • Drive a LEAN approach to the test labs.

  • Build a strong global connection with the Ford North American and European test labs

  • Lead the Test Engineering Quality initiatives and create a quality first culture in the labs.

  • Support the Design & Release Engineering teams in root cause investigations and problem resolution of testing or field failures.

  • Hold teams accountable for robust root cause identification engineering countermeasures and positive verification.



Qualifications
  • Education: Bachelors degree in mechanical engineering or automotive equivalent.

  • Experience: Minimum 5 years of proven experience in a engineering testing environment.

  • Ability to work across blue & white collar workforces with a good understanding of the different industrial considerations in working with a trade workforce.

  • A proven history in creating a strong Health & Safety culture in the workplace.

  • Technical & Communication Skills: Demonstrated strong technical acumen combined with excellent interpersonal and communication skills.

  • Problem-Solving: Proven ability to effectively solve complex engineering issues through the use of key engineering problem solving tools (e.g: G8D 5Y etc.)

  • Organizational Skills: Adept at multitasking and managing a diverse range of activities.

  • Leadership: Demonstrated ability to lead initiatives influence stakeholders and foster collaborative relationships.
